[Go to CFHT Home Page] Man Pages
Back to Software Index  BORDER=0Manpage Top Level
    iconv(5) manual page Table of Contents

Name

iconv - code set conversion tables

Description

The following code set conversions are supported:

    Code Set Conversions Supported
Code    Symbol    Target Code    Symbol    comment
ISO 646    646    ISO 8859-1    8859    US Ascii
ISO 646de    646de    ISO 8859-1    8859    German
ISO 646da    646da    ISO 8859-1    8859    Danish
ISO 646en    646en    ISO 8859-1    8859    English Ascii
ISO 646es    646es    ISO 8859-1    8859    Spanish
ISO 646fr    646fr    ISO 8859-1    8859    French
ISO 646it    646it    ISO 8859-1    8859    Italian
ISO 646sv    646sv    ISO 8859-1    8859    Swedish
ISO 8859-1    8859    ISO 646    646    7 bit Ascii
ISO 8859-1    8859    ISO 646de    646de    German
ISO 8859-1    8859    ISO 646da    646da    Danish
ISO 8859-1    8859    ISO 646en    646en    English Ascii
ISO 8859-1    8859    ISO 646es    646es    Spanish
ISO 8859-1    8859    ISO 646fr    646fr    French
ISO 8859-1    8859    ISO 646it    646it    Italian
ISO 8859-1    8859    ISO 646sv    646sv    Swedish

The conversions are performed according to the tables following. All values in the tables are given in octal.

ISO 646 (US ASCII) to ISO 8859-1

For the conversion of ISO 646 to ISO 8859-1 all characters in ISO 646 can be mapped unchanged to ISO 8859-1

ISO 646de (GERMAN) to ISO 8859-1

For the conversion of ISO 646de to ISO 8859-1 all characters not in the following table are mapped unchanged.

Conversions Performed
ISO 646de    ISO 8859-1
100    247
133    304
134    326
135    334
173    344
174    366
175    374
176    337


ISO 646da (DANISH) to ISO 8859-1

For the conversion of ISO 646da to ISO 8859-1 all characters not in the following table are mapped unchanged.


Conversions Performed
ISO 646da    ISO 8859-1
133    306
134    330
135    305
173    346
174    370
175    345


ISO 646en (ENGLISH ASCII) to ISO 8859-1

For the conversion of ISO 646en to ISO 8859-1 all characters not in the following table are mapped unchanged.


Conversions Performed
ISO 646en    ISO 8859-1
043    243



ISO 646fr (FRENCH) to ISO 8859-1For the conversion of ISO 646fr to ISO 8859-1
all characters not in the following table are mapped unchanged.     
Conversions Performed
ISO 646fr    ISO 8859-1
043    243
100    340
133    260
134    347
135    247
173    351
174    371
175    350
176    250



ISO 646it (ITALIAN) to ISO 8859-1For the conversion of ISO 646it to ISO
8859-1 all characters not in the following table are mapped unchanged.  
  
Conversions Performed
ISO 646it    ISO 8859-1
043    243
100    247
133    260
134    347
135    351
140    371
173    340
174    362
175    350
176    354



ISO 646es (SPANISH) to ISO 8859-1For the conversion of ISO 646es to ISO
8859-1 all characters not in the following table are mapped unchanged.  
  
Conversions Performed
ISO 646es    ISO 8859-1
100    247
133    241
134    321
135    277
173    260
174    361
175    347




ISO 646sv (SWEDISH) to ISO 8859-1For the conversion of ISO 646sv to ISO
8859-1 all characters not in the following table are mapped unchanged.  
  
Conversions Performed
ISO 646sv    ISO 8859-1
100    311
133    304
134    326
135    305
136    334
140    351
173    344
174    366
175    345
176    374



ISO 8859-1 to ISO 646 (ASCII)For the conversion of ISO 8859-1 to ISO 646
all characters not in the following table are mapped unchanged.     
Converted to Underscore ’_’ (137)
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242 243 244 245 246 247
250 251 252 253 254 255 256 257
260 261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303 304 305 306 307
310 311 312 313 314 315 316 317
320 321 322 323 324 325 326 327
330 331 332 333 334 335 336 337
330 331 332 333 334 335 336 337
340 341 342 343 344 345 346 347
350 351 352 353 354 355 356 357
360 361 362 363 364 365 366 367
370 371 372 373 374 375 376 377



ISO 8859-1 to ISO 646de (GERMAN)For the conversion of ISO 8859-1 to ISO 646de
all characters not in the following tables are mapped unchanged.     
Conversions Performed
ISO 8859-1    ISO 646de
247    100
304    133
326    134
334    135
337    176
344    173
366    174
374    175



Converted to Underscore ’_’ (137)
100 133 134 135 173 174 175 176
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242 243 244 245 246 
250 251 252 253 254 255 256 257
260 261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303     305 306 307
310 311 312 313 314 315 316 317
320 321 322 323 324 325     327
330 331 332 333     335 336 337
340 341 342 343     345 346 347
350 351 352 353 354 355 356 357
360 361 362 363 364 365     367
370 371 372 373     375 376 377




ISO 8859-1 to ISO 646da (DANISH)For the conversion of ISO 8859-1 to ISO 646da
all characters not in the following tables are mapped unchanged.     
Conversions Performed
ISO 8859-1    ISO 646da
305    135
306    133
330    134
345    175
346    173
370    174



Converted to Underscore ’_’ (137)
133 134 135 173 174 175 
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242 243 244 245 246 247
250 251 252 253 254 255 256 257
260 261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303 304         307
310 311 312 313 314 315 316 317
320 321 322 323 324 325 326 327
    331 332 333 334 335 336 337
340 341 342 343 344         347
350 351 352 353 354 355 356 357
360 361 362 363 364 365 366 367
    371 372 373 374     376 377



ISO 8859-1 to ISO 646en (ENGLISH ASCII)For the conversion of ISO 8859-1 to
ISO 646en all characters not in the following tables are mapped unchanged.
    
Conversions Performed
ISO 8859-1    ISO 646en
243    043



Converted to Underscore ’_’ (137)
043
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242     244 245 246 247
250 251 252 253 254 255 256 257
260 261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303 304 305 306 307
310 311 312 313 314 315 316 317
320 321 322 323 324 325 326 327
330 331 332 333 334 335 336 337
340 341 342 343 344 345 346 347
350 351 352 353 354 355 356 357
360 361 362 363 364 365 366 367
370 371 372 373 374 375 376 377



ISO 8859-1 to ISO 646fr (FRENCH)For the conversion of ISO 8859-1 to ISO 646fr
all characters not in the following tables are mapped unchanged.     
Conversions Performed
ISO 8859-1    ISO 646fr
243    043
247    135
250    176
260    133
340    100
347    134
350    175
351    173
371    174



Converted to Underscore ’_’ (137)
043
100 133 134 135 173 174 175 176
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242     244 245 246 
    251 252 253 254 255 256 257
    261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303 304 305 306 307
310 311 312 313 314 315 316 317
320 321 322 323 324 325 326 327
330 331 332 333 334 335 336 337
    341 342 343 344 345 346 
        352 353 354 355 356 357
360 361 362 363 364 365 366 367
370     372 373 374 375 376 377


ISO 8859-1 to ISO 646it (ITALIAN)For the conversion of ISO 8859-1 to ISO
646it all characters not in the following tables are mapped unchanged. 
   
Conversions Performed
ISO 8859-1    ISO 646it
243    043
247    100
260    133
340    173
347    134
350    175
351    135
354    176
362    174
371    140



Converted to Underscore ’_’ (137)
043
100 133 134 135 173 174 175 176
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242     244 245 246 
250 251 252 253 254 255 256 257
    261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303 304 305 306 307
310 311 312 313 314 315 316 317
320 321 322 323 324 325 326 327
330 331 332 333 334 335 336 337
    341 342 343 344 345 346 
    352 353 354 355 356 357
360 361     363 364 365 366 367
370     372 373 374 375 376 377


ISO 8859-1 to ISO 646es (SPANISH)For the conversion of ISO 8859-1 to ISO
646es all characters not in the following tables are mapped unchanged. 
   
Conversions Performed
ISO 8859-1    ISO 646es
241    133
247    100
260    173
277    135
321    134
347    175
361    174



Converted to Underscore ’_’ (137)
100 133 134 135 173 174 175 
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240     242 243 244 245 246 
250 251 252 253 254 255 256 257
    261 262 263 264 265 266 267
270 271 272 273 274 275 276 
300 301 302 303 304 305 306 307
310 311 312 313 314 315 316 317
320     322 323 324 325 326 327
330 331 332 333 334 335 336 337
340 341 342 343 344 345 346 
350 351 352 353 354 355 356 357
360     362 363 364 365 366 367
370 371 372 373 374 375 376 377


ISO 8859-1 to ISO 646sv (SWEDISH)For the conversion of ISO 8859-1 to ISO
646sv all characters not in the following tables are mapped unchanged. 
   
Conversions Performed
ISO 8859-1    ISO 646sv
304    133
305    135
311    100
326    134
334    136
344    173
345    175
351    140
366    174
374    176



Converted to Underscore ’_’ (137)
100 133 134 135 136 140
173 174 175 176
200 201 202 203 204 205 206 207
210 211 212 213 214 215 216 217
220 221 222 223 224 225 226 227
230 231 232 233 234 235 236 237
240 241 242 243 244 245 246 247
250 251 252 253 254 255 256 257
260 261 262 263 264 265 266 267
270 271 272 273 274 275 276 277
300 301 302 303         306 307
310     312 313 314 315 316 317
320 321 322 323 324 325     327
330 331 332 333     335 336 337
340 341 342 343         346 347
350     352 353 354 355 356 357
360 361 362 363 364 365     367
370 371 372 373     375 376 377

Files /usr/lib/iconv/*.so conversion modules /usr/lib/iconv/*.t conversion
tables /usr/lib/iconv/iconv_data list of conversions supported by conversion
tables  See Alsoiconv(1), iconv(3)